代码签名证书支持的类型有哪些?
代码签名证书可以为应用程序、脚本、驱动程序等代码文件提供验证签名,确保文件在传输和执行过程中未被篡改,并且来源可信。这类证书通常由受信任的证书颁发机构(CA)颁发,并在软件开发和分发过程中扮演着重要角色。代码签名证书支持的类型有哪些呢?
在代码签名证书的种类中,主要包括个人版代码签名证书、企业版OV代码签名证书以及专业版EV代码签名证书。每种类型的证书针对不同的使用场景和需求,具有不同的特点和功能:
一、个人版代码签名证书是专为个人开发者设计的证书类型
这种证书适用于个人开发者、独立软件开发者或小型开发团队,他们需要保护自己的应用程序,防止被黑客篡改或伪装成其他软件进行传播。个人版代码签名证书的申请过程相对简便,通常只需要提供开发者的身份证明,验证开发者的身份即可。由于其主要面向个人开发者,因此其认证过程和需求较为简单。申请者只需提供个人身份信息或电子邮件地址即可获得证书,价格较为亲民,适合中小型开发者或个人开发者使用。
二、企业版OV代码签名证书主要面向企业和商业组织
OV代码签名证书的申请过程更为严格,它要求申请者提供公司相关的法律文件、税务信息和其他身份验证资料。企业版证书可以确保签名的软件来自一个已验证的合法企业,增强了用户对软件来源的信任度。企业版代码签名证书的认证级别更高,通常需要证书颁发机构(CA)对申请者的公司背景进行审核。对于企业来说,OV证书不仅可以提供更高的安全性,还能增强企业形象,向客户展示其对软件安全的重视,提升用户的信任感。
三、最为高级的证书类型是专业版EV代码签名证书
这种证书提供了最高级别的身份验证,并对软件的安全性提供更强的保障。EV代码签名证书不仅要求企业提交详细的法律文件和背景调查,而且其申请过程更加严格,需要证书颁发机构对公司的法律身份、物理地址、公司代表等信息进行彻底的审核。EV代码签名证书的最大优势在于它提供了更高的信任等级,能够大幅提高用户对软件来源的信任,特别是在下载和安装大型或重要应用程序时,能有效减少用户的安全顾虑。这种证书通常适用于大型企业、金融机构、政府组织以及需要确保最大安全性的软件开发者。
代码签名证书支持的类型各有特点,适用于不同的用户需求和安全级别。选择合适的代码签名证书类型不仅能提高软件的安全性,保护用户免受恶意软件攻击,还能为软件开发者和公司赢得用户的信赖,增强品牌形象。